Silk is obtained from silkworms and culturing of silkworms is called sericulture. It is also called silk farming. China and India are the leading producers of silk i.e, about 60% of the world’s silk production. Silkworms feed on leaves of different varieties of plants like mulberry, oak, munga, and tussar. All these varieties of silk are found in India. There are several commercial species of silkworms but the most widely used and studied silkworms are Bombyx moris which is a domestic silkworm.
Additional Information: - it is believed that silk was first prepared in china during the neolithic period later it became one of the important cottage industries in the world.
- a continuous filament that contains protein fibroin secreted by the salivary glands of silkworm and gum called sericin forms silk.
- the serin present in silkworms are removed by placing them in hot water.
- there are various steps in the production of silk such as sericulture, extraction of thread, dyeing, spinning, weaving, and finishing.
- silk is of different types namely muga silk, ahimsa silk, tri silk, mulberry silk, pat silk, tussar silk. India is the largest producer and exporter of silk.
So, the correct answer is ‘India’.
Note: Muga silk is one of the varieties of silk which is in yellowish gold in color found in Assam, a state in India’. The highest quality of silk is obtained from bombyx Mori is mulberry silk. Tussar silk is produced by silkworms belonging to the species Antheraea.
